Top Fashion Stories of the Week: November 11
Fashion News

Top Fashion Stories of the Week: November 11

Eleanore Beatty November 13, 2022 Article

This week, the fashion industry celebrated milestones, with award ceremonies, ribbon cuttings and campaign releases alike. At the top of the week, Emily Adams Bode Aujla of Bode was named the 2022 American Menswear Designer of the Year at this year’s CFDA awards, marking her second time earning the title. Robert Pattinson appeared dapper in Dior‘s Spring 2023 menswear campaign, and Red Hot Chilli Peppers’ Flea wore hotly-anticipated Stüssy x Dries Van Noten designs in the duo’s official imagery. Elsewhere, Supreme opened its Chicago store, Dover Street Market opened a new location in Beijing and GOLF WANG announced a forthcoming outpost in New York City.

Bode Was Named the 2022 CFDA Menswear Designer of the Year

Bode Wins Designer of the Year and Robert Pattinson Fronts Dior in This Week's Top Fashion News

Taylor Hill/Filmmagic/Getty Images

The CFDA on Monday held its annual Fashion Awards at Cipriani South Street at Casa Cipriani in Manhattan.

Among those who took home titles, Emily Adams Bode Aujla of Bode was named the American Menswear Designer of the Year. Notably, Bode, who founded her luxury namesake label in 2016, also claimed the honorary distinction last year. For 2022, the designer was up against Fear of God’s Jerry Lorenzo, Amiri’s Mike Amiri, Thom Browne and Willy Chavarria.

Additionally, Catherine Holstein for Khaite received the American Womenswear Designer of the Year award. Raul Lopez of Luar won Accessory Designer of the Year, and Elena Velez earned the American Emerging Designer of the Year title. Image architect Law Roach received the CFDA’s first-ever Stylist Award, and industry maverick Patti Wilson won the Media Award in honor of Eugenia Shepphard.

Robert Pattinson Fronted Dior’s Spring 2023 Menswear Campaign

Bode Wins Designer of the Year and Robert Pattinson Fronts Dior in This Week's Top Fashion News

Rafael Pavarotti

Kim Jones debuted Dior’s Spring 2023 menswear campaign starring none other than Robert Pattinson. The sartorial imagery, which spotlights the House’s “California Couture” collection with ERL, was shot by photographer Rafael Pavarotti.

Where the collection embraced an ideal blend of Venice Beach style, ’90s tailoring and subcultural codes, the campaign takes on a much more refined aesthetic. In it, Pattinson plays the signature Dior man, donning clean-cut ensembles against youthful backdrops in pops of green, red and blue.

Supreme Opened a New Chicago Store

Bode Wins Designer of the Year and Robert Pattinson Fronts Dior in This Week's Top Fashion News

Supreme

After decorating the city with wheat-pasted posters to generate excitement, Supreme has opened its newest brick-and-mortar location in Chicago.

The outside of the store boasts brick walls that are dyed in a bright white tone, letting the New York label’s signature box logo stand out in red. Inside, the outpost includes an oversized, gilded sphinx installation that calls back to Supreme’s collaboration with Mark Gonzales. Both sides of the space host shelves stocked with tees, hats and sneakers.

Supreme Chicago is located at 1438 N. Milwaukee Ave. Its doors are now open to the public.

Stüssy x Dries Van Noten Delivered a Collaborative Campaign Starring Flea

Bode Wins Designer of the Year and Robert Pattinson Fronts Dior in This Week's Top Fashion News

Tyrone Lebon

Following teasers from A$AP NAST and a short video from the duo itself, Stüssy and Dries Van Noten delivered their official collaborative campaign, starring Red Hot Chilli Peppers’ founding member and bassist, Flea.

The campaign, shot by Tyrone Lebon, sees the rocker playing his bass guitar, shooting hoops and looking jolly in the collaborative garments from Stüssy x Dries Van Noten. Across the sartorial effort, the partnership breeds a slew of designs denoted by Stüssy’s So-Cal style and Dries’ versatile codes. Among them, there are dual-branded tie-dye T-shirts, sweatpants and sweatshirts, along with collared shirts, baggy printed jeans, and a rhinestone smoking blazer and pants.

Stüssy and Dries Van Noten will be available worldwide at select chapter stores, select Dover Street Market locations, Dries Van Noten stores, on Stüssy’s website and Dries Van Noten’s website, on Friday, November 18 at 10 a.m. PST, 10 a.m. CET, and 10 a.m JST per the respective region.

GOLF WANG Has a New York City Storefront Coming

Bode Wins Designer of the Year and Robert Pattinson Fronts Dior in This Week's Top Fashion News

Golf Wang

Tyler, the Creator’s GOLF WANG brand is prepping to expand its property portfolio with an all-new storefront in New York City.

The newly-announced outpost will mark the label’s second-ever brick-and-mortar location, following its inaugural shop on Fairfax Ave. in Los Angeles, CA (just down the street from the Supreme store). At the time of the announcement, no details were provided regarding the store’s location or appearance, though the brand did confirm that the store will open its doors on November 12.

The label has since added the official address to its Instagram bio: the store is located in NYC’s Soho neighborhood at 35 Howard St. Store hours are not yet available.

Royal College of Art Announced a New Virgil Abloh Scholarship

Bode Wins Designer of the Year and Robert Pattinson Fronts Dior in This Week's Top Fashion News

Edward Berthelot/Getty Images

The Royal College of Art (RCA) in London announced a new scholarship in honor of the late visionary Virgil Abloh, aimed at helping provide educational opportunities for disadvantaged Black British students.

The RCA Virgil Abloh Scholarship, which will cover the full cost of tuition, will begin next year. As the school puts it, “This initiative aims to help break down barriers to education and support the next generation of visionary designers and innovators.”

In addition to a full-ride scholarship, the selected student will gain industry experience and networking opportunities with the help of British fashion designer Samuel Ross and fellow creative industries partners throughout their studies. Notably, Abloh had a long-standing relationship with the institution, having joined the school’s teaching roster as an Honorary Visiting Professor in 2020.

Dover Street Market Opened a New Store in Beijing

Bode Wins Designer of the Year and Robert Pattinson Fronts Dior in This Week's Top Fashion News

Dover Street Market Beijing

Following a 12-year stint inside Beijing’s Taikoo Li Sanlitun mall, Dover Street Market has moved its sole storefront in China to the luxury shopping complex WF Centra.

Located just a few minutes from the city’s historical Forbidden City landmark, the new three-story DSM Beijing outpost is said to be 40{a78e43caf781a4748142ac77894e52b42fd2247cba0219deedaee5032d61bfc9} larger than the brand’s last location. Like its other locations, the Beijing brick-and-mortar will sell an expansive lineup of brands including Post Archive Faction (PAF), Rick Owens, sacai, Junya Watanabe MAN, Dries Van Noten, Celine, Valentino and more. Notably, Supreme will be sold in China for the first time via DSM Beijing.
